Region Origin: Western Asia
Meaning: He will add

Yoseph is a name of Hebrew origin, derived from the biblical name Joseph, which means "He will add" or "May God add/increase." The name has deep cultural and historical significance, as it is prominently featured in the Bible as the name of the son of Jacob and Rachel, who became a powerful figure in Egyptian society. In the Old Testament, Joseph was known for his wisdom, leadership, and ability to interpret dreams, which ultimately led to his rise to power in Egypt. His story of being sold into slavery by his brothers, only to later become a trusted advisor to the Pharaoh, is a timeless tale of resilience and forgiveness. The name Yoseph is still popular among Jewish, Christian, and Muslim communities, as it is seen as a symbol of strength, faith, and perseverance. In Jewish tradition, Joseph is considered one of the twelve tribes of Israel, and his descendants are believed to have played a significant role in shaping the history of the Jewish people.
